Nutrition for Hair Growth in Lithuania: Protein, Iron and Vitamin D

Hair needs enough building material. Low protein intake, low ferritin or vitamin D deficiency can add diffuse shedding on top of genetic hair loss.

In Lithuania, vitamin D is often discussed because of long low-light seasons. Testing is still better than guessing, especially when several supplements are already being taken.

Iron status matters for many women, but men can also have relevant deficiencies. Blood work should be interpreted with a clinician, not isolated from symptoms.

Correcting a deficiency will not replace a transplant, but it may make the treatment plan cleaner and easier to evaluate.
